随着互联网技术的飞速发展,电子商务行业在我国呈现出蓬勃发展的态势。B2C(Business-to-Consumer)模式作为一种新兴的电商模式,逐渐成为企业拓展市场、提升品牌形象的重要手段。为了满足消费者日益多样化的需求,B2C网站模块化构建应运而生。本文将从模块化构建的意义、优势以及具体实施策略三个方面展开论述。
一、B2C网站模块化构建的意义
1. 提升用户体验

模块化构建的核心思想是将网站划分为多个功能模块,每个模块负责特定的功能。这样,消费者在浏览和购买商品时,可以更加便捷、直观地找到所需信息。模块化设计有助于提高网站的可扩展性,为未来功能的添加和优化提供便利。
2. 降低开发成本
模块化构建有利于实现代码复用,降低开发成本。企业可以将通用的功能模块进行封装,形成标准化的组件,便于在不同项目中重复使用。模块化设计还能提高开发效率,缩短项目周期。
3. 便于后期维护
模块化构建使得网站维护更加便捷。当某个模块出现问题时,只需针对该模块进行修复,而不会影响其他模块的正常运行。模块化设计有利于版本控制,便于团队成员协同工作。
4. 提高网站安全性
模块化构建有助于提高网站安全性。通过将功能模块进行隔离,可以降低系统漏洞的风险。一旦发现某个模块存在安全隐患,只需对该模块进行修复,而不会影响整个网站的安全性。
二、B2C网站模块化构建的优势
1. 功能丰富
模块化构建可以实现丰富的功能,满足不同企业的需求。企业可以根据自身业务特点,选择合适的模块进行组合,打造个性化、功能强大的B2C网站。
2. 易于扩展
模块化设计使得网站易于扩展。企业可以根据业务发展需求,添加或修改现有模块,以满足不断变化的市场需求。
3. 提高开发效率
模块化构建有利于提高开发效率。通过复用通用模块,开发人员可以节省大量时间,加快项目进度。
4. 降低维护成本
模块化设计使得网站维护更加便捷,从而降低维护成本。企业只需关注核心模块的更新和维护,而无需对整个网站进行大规模的修改。
三、B2C网站模块化构建的实施策略
1. 明确需求
在构建B2C网站之前,企业需明确自身业务需求,确定所需的功能模块。这有助于提高模块化设计的针对性,降低开发难度。
2. 选择合适的开发框架
选择合适的开发框架是实现模块化构建的关键。企业可根据自身需求,选择适合的框架,如Vue.js、React等。
3. 设计模块接口
模块接口是模块之间相互协作的桥梁。在设计模块接口时,需充分考虑模块的独立性、可扩展性和可复用性。
4. 实现模块化开发
按照模块接口,将网站划分为多个功能模块,实现模块化开发。在开发过程中,注重代码规范,提高代码质量。
5. 测试与优化
完成模块化开发后,对各个模块进行测试,确保其正常运行。根据测试结果对模块进行优化,提高网站性能。
B2C网站模块化构建在提升用户体验、降低开发成本、便于后期维护等方面具有显著优势。企业应充分认识到模块化构建的重要性,积极探索和实践,以推动我国电商行业的持续发展。